Output a05ae7806253f7538c26d516114d5938cb09c4ecb160e7c057f993ff24420f0e:1

value
21215393
script pubkey
OP_0 OP_PUSHBYTES_32 da6fd2baf37903488a15d076a1c17461ded30fe4f809fe4f4c89820408c9d72a
address
bc1qmfha9whn0yp53zs46pm2rst5v80dxrlylqylun6v3xpqgzxf6u4qszyut2
transaction
a05ae7806253f7538c26d516114d5938cb09c4ecb160e7c057f993ff24420f0e
spent
true